Fastly helps people stay better connected with the things they love. Fastly’s edge cloud platform enables customers to create great digital experiences quickly, securely, and reliably by processing, serving, and securing our customers’ applications as close to their end-users as possible — at the edge of the Internet. The platform is designed to take advantage of the modern internet, to be programmable, and to support agile software development. Fastly’s customers include Vimeo, Pinterest, The New York Times, and GitHub. We\'re building a more trustworthy Internet. Come join us. Posting information

We’re looking for a

Staff Salesforce Developer

to join our GTM Business Systems team. This team is responsible for designing, building, and scaling the business systems that power the entire customer lifecycle — from initial lead acquisition to sales, renewals, billing, customer success, and advocacy. Our ecosystem includes Salesforce Sales Cloud, Service Cloud and CPQ, Marketo, NetSuite, Workato, Logisense, and Fastly products. Architect, design, and implement

scalable Salesforce solutions across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, and CPQ using Apex, Lightning Web Components (LWCs), and Salesforce APIs. Lead technical design reviews

and ensure best practices for security, performance, maintainability, and scalability. Partner with product owners and business stakeholders

to gather requirements and deliver high-impact solutions aligned with GTM strategy. Develop and maintain integrations

between Salesforce and systems like NetSuite, Workato (for automation/orchestration), Marketo, Logisense (billing), and internal Fastly systems. Drive engineering best practices

— including code review standards, and automated testing — to ensure high-quality releases. Mentor and guide Salesforce developers , providing technical leadership and code review feedback. Identify and resolve performance bottlenecks , ensuring the platform is optimized for scale and data integrity. Continuously improve documentation , internal technical knowledge, and operational processes. Participate in

agile ceremonies , release planning, and deployment activities as part of our SDLC. What We're Looking For

7+ years of progressive experience as a Salesforce Developer, Technical Lead, or Architect, with at least 3 years at a senior/staff engineer level. Expertise in Apex, SOQL, Lightning Web Components, and Salesforce APIs , with a history of building complex enterprise-grade solutions. Strong understanding of Salesforce platform architecture, data modeling, security model, and governor limits. Proven experience implementing

Quote-to-Cash and Subscription Management processes

in Salesforce (CPQ, Advanced Approvals, Subscription/Contract automation). Hands-on experience with

Workato or similar integration platforms

to build robust cross-system workflows. Familiarity with NetSuite ERP, Logisense (or other billing platforms), and marketing automation tools (Marketo preferred). Experience leading

end-to-end development projects , including requirements gathering, solution design, implementation, and rollout. Knowledge of Salesforce permissions, profiles, sharing rules, and reporting/dashboards Experience with CI/CD pipelines (Gearset, Copado, or equivalent) and Git-based version control. Excellent communication skills, with the ability to explain complex solutions to business and technical stakeholders. Nice to have

Hands-on experience with

Platform Events, Async Apex, custom metadata types, and high-volume data strategies . Salesforce certifications such as

Platform Developer II, Application Architect, or System Architect . Contributions to Salesforce open-source projects, Trailhead Ranger status, or active Salesforce community involvement. Work details
